Appearance
Hercules #3 BX features dense, medium-sized buds that are visually striking, often displaying a vibrant lime green color. These buds are further accented by deep purple hues along the pistils. Millions of glistening trichomes cover each bud, indicating high cannabinoid content and contributing to its aesthetic appeal.
The plant's leaves present a mosaic of light and dark green, sometimes showing hints of orange under specific lighting. Its robust genetic health is reflected in its dense structure, which supports significant resin production, making it a favored choice for cultivation.
Aroma & Flavor
The aroma of Hercules #3 BX is complex, beginning with a blend of citrusy notes and subtle earthy undertones. It is often described as sweet and herbal, reminiscent of fresh citrus and cut grass, enhanced by its rich terpene profile. The scent intensifies during flowering, filling grow spaces with a tangy, invigorating fragrance.
Its flavor profile is vibrant and multi-dimensional, starting with a burst of citrus and hints of tropical fruits. As the taste develops, notes of spice and earthiness emerge, creating a well-rounded experience that mirrors its aroma. The lingering aftertaste is sweet and herbaceous.
Effects
Hercules #3 BX is primarily known for its sativa-driven effects, which are generally described as cerebral, energetic, and euphoric. It is favored for its ability to promote creativity and provide a clear-headed uplift.
Terpenes & Cannabinoids
Laboratory analyses of Hercules #3 BX have identified key terpenes such as Myrcene, Limonene, Caryophyllene, and Pinene. These contribute to its distinct aroma and flavor profiles, with Limonene and Myrcene noted for their high concentrations. The strain typically exhibits THC levels ranging from 18% to 24%, with CBD present in trace amounts, generally below 1%.
